WebStaff attrition rate = Amount of attritions/total number of employees x 100. Let’s say at the beginning of the year you had 800 people. Throughout 2024, you hired 150 people and 130 people left. That means that the total number of employees in 2024 was 950 (800+150). Then your staff attrition rate is equal 13,7: 130/950*100. Fortunately, there are insurance options that provide you with financial … WebTherefore, for 10 years' service, the tax-free limit for the year ending 30 June 2024 is: $10,989 + ($5,496 × 10) = $10,989 + $54,960 = $65,949. The tax-free component of a genuine redundancy or early retirement scheme payment is shown at lump sum D on the employee's income statement or PAYG payment summary – individual non-business.
